Stock market sees mixed results with gains and losses
Ghana’s stock market saw mixed results this week, with the GSE-Composite Index rising by 2.04% while the GSE-Financial Stocks Index decreased by -1.70%.
The market capitalization also increased by 0.78% to reach GH¢64.10 billion.
Throughout the week, 24 equities were traded, with some companies experiencing gains such as BOPP, TOTAL, and MTNGH, while others saw losses such as GCB, UNIL, GGBL, SOGEGH, CAL, and GOIL.
GAINER & DECLINERS
Ticker | Close Price (GH¢) | Open Price (GH¢) | Price Change | Y-t-D Change |
BOPP | 9.65 | 8.80 | 0.85 | 50.55% |
TOTAL | 4.13 | 4.06 | 0.07 | -6.14% |
MTNGH | 0.88 | 0.82 | 0.06 | 0.00% |
GCB | 3.15 | 3.51 | -0.36 | -32.69% |
UNIL | 2.06 | 2.25 | -0.19 | -63.08% |
GGBL | 1.86 | 2.05 | -0.19 | -12.68% |
SOGEGH | 0.90 | 1.00 | -0.10 | -19.64% |
CAL | 0.51 | 0.56 | -0.05 | -37.04% |
GOIL | 1.68 | 1.70 | -0.02 | -6.67% |
The total volume of shares traded was 1,913,758, valued at GH¢4,251,660, showing a significant increase of 112.06% in volume traded and 413.89% in trade turnover compared to the previous week.
The largest portion of the week’s traded value, 43.75%, was represented by GGBL, with shares valued at GH¢1,860,000.00.
